#MicronMarketCapBreaks1Trillion
On May 26, shares of Micron Technology surged 19.3 percent in a single trading session, pushing the company’s market capitalization above the historic 1 trillion US dollar milestone for the very first time. The explosive rally instantly turned Micron into one of the hottest names across the global semiconductor sector and reignited investor excitement around the artificial intelligence driven chip boom.
The sharp rise came after Micron delivered stronger than expected financial results and optimistic forward guidance, signaling accelerating demand for high bandwidth memory, AI server chips, and next generation data center infrastructure. As artificial intelligence competition intensifies worldwide, memory chips have become one of the most critical components powering advanced AI systems, cloud computing, and machine learning platforms. Micron is now emerging as one of the biggest beneficiaries of this transformation.
Market analysts pointed to rapidly growing demand from AI giants, hyperscale cloud providers, and enterprise computing firms as the key catalyst behind the rally. The company’s latest outlook suggested that demand for advanced DRAM and NAND memory products is growing much faster than expected, especially in AI servers where memory capacity requirements continue to expand aggressively.
The semiconductor industry has entered a new era where AI infrastructure spending is driving unprecedented capital inflows. Investors are increasingly rotating capital into companies directly connected to AI hardware production, and Micron’s breakout performance reflects the broader market belief that memory chips will play a central role in the next technological cycle.
The rally also strengthened bullish sentiment across the wider chip sector. Major semiconductor companies experienced renewed buying momentum as traders interpreted Micron’s earnings as confirmation that AI demand remains exceptionally strong despite broader macroeconomic uncertainty. Many analysts now believe that the global AI hardware race is still in its early stages, leaving significant room for future growth across semiconductor supply chains.
Micron’s trillion dollar breakthrough represents more than just a stock market milestone. It highlights how rapidly AI is reshaping global capital markets and redefining the strategic importance of semiconductor manufacturers. Companies capable of supplying the infrastructure behind AI development are now becoming some of the most valuable businesses in the world.
As competition intensifies between global technology leaders, semiconductor dominance is increasingly viewed as a core pillar of future economic and technological power. Micron’s historic surge may therefore signal the beginning of an even larger institutional shift toward AI infrastructure related assets in the months ahead.
